What you will do

In this role, you will position and sell licenses for Data Management, Balance Sheet Management, Profitability Management, Enterprise Risk Management, Basel, IFRS9 Reporting, AML, and Financial Crime Compliance to customers in the South Africa Development Community (SADC).

  • Ability to generate a pipeline for the assigned solution portfolio in the designated region
  • Delivery license revenue as per targets across Risk & Finance and Financial Crime Compliance solutions in the assigned region
  • Build a deep and active engagement model with Prospects & Clients.
  • Creating a tailored ‘case for transformation’ and solution proposal with a supporting argument for each opportunity
  • Sales lead generation and pipeline management including periodic reporting as requested by the manager.
  • Leverage collaboration across the larger ecosystem of extended Oracle teams, partners, and industry players (consultants, industry groups, analysts, etc) to achieve the sales objectives defined above.

Desired Experience

  • Seasoned software sales professional with an understanding of the BFSI Industry.
  • Prior experience in positioning solutions that address business requirements for Data Management, Balance Sheet Management, Profitability Management, Enterprise Risk Management as well as Accounting and Regulatory Reporting, Financial Crime and Compliance (AML, Customer Screening, Transaction Filtering, KYC, Investigation and Reporting)
  • Experience in shaping and developing significant investment initiatives / projects of $US and upwards, including business case development, detailed solution scope, implementation approach and plan, etc.
  • Deep knowledge of the assigned region’s banking and insurance industry is vital.
